Punjab is gearing up for elections. There is a lot of speculation around the electoral moves of major parties as the election result would set foundation for the 2019 general elections.

Amidst all the action, Navjot Singh Sidhu managed to grab attention by joining Congress. On Sunday, the cricketer-turned-politician took to Twitter to share the news.

Twitter was not impressed and people were quick to dig out Sidhu’s old posts in which he criticised Congress and the party’s vice-president in strong words.

At the centre of it all was an old video of Sidhu, in his good old BJP days, where he is seen taking a dig at Rahul Gandhi.

Comedy Days With Rahul?

But it was Sidhu’s meeting with Congress Vice-President Rahul Gandhi that created a laughing riot on Twitter. The pictures of the two leaders greeting each other became the butt of jokes.

People were seen altering the image with Sidhu’s image with Kapil Sharma from the show ‘Comedy Nights with Kapil’ in which Sidhu makes a regular appearance.

Betraying His Own Kind?

Some were even hurt by his decision as they saw it as an incident where a Sikh was siding with the party largely responsible for the 1984 anti-Sikh riots.

Sidhu’s move also led people to point fingers at politicians who switch loyalties as per convenience.

Sidhu 'Stabbed' BJP on Its Back, ‘Cheated’ People of Punjab: Harsimrat Kaur Badal

Union Minister for Food Processing Industries Harsimrat Kaur Badal condemned Sidhu for joining Congress. (Photo: IANS)

Union Minister and Shiromani Akali Dal (SAD) leader Harsimrat Kaur Badal called Sidhu a ‘traitor’ . She said by joining Congress, Sidhu has betrayed his “mother party” which brought him into politics.

Taking a dig at Sidhu, she said that his pratice to laugh in the comedy show on the small screen has also helped him to make his own mockery.

She said that there was no danger to Akali Dal from Sidhu with his joining the Congress party since Sidhu has always remained an “aimless” politician.
